This form addresses important considerations that may effect the legal rights and obligations of the parties in a limited power of attorney matter. This questionnaire enables those seeking legal help to effectively identify and prepare their issues and problems. Thorough advance preparation enhances the attorneys case evaluation and can significantly reduce costs associated with case preparation.



This questionnaire may also be used by an attorney as an important information gathering and issue identification tool when forming an attorney-client relationship with a new client. This form helps ensure thorough case preparation and effective evaluation of a new clients needs. It may be used by an attorney or new client to save on attorney fees related to initial interviews.

The best person to give power of attorney is someone you trust completely, as they will be making important decisions on your behalf. This person should understand your wishes and values. It's common to select a family member, close friend, or a trusted advisor.
